FORT BRAGG, N.C. — A paratrooper stationed at Fort Bragg died Wednesday from an improvised explosive device in Aghanistan, the Defense Department said Thursday. 

Cpl. Benjamin H. Neal, of Orfordville, Wis., was killed in the Zharay District, Kandahar Province. 

Neal was assigned to the 1st Battalion, 508th Parachute Infantry Regiment, 4th Brigade Combat Team, 82nd Airborne Division at Fort Bragg. 

Neal joined the Army in 2009 and has received the NATO medal, the Bronze Star, the Purple Heart, the Army Commendation Medla, the Army Good Conduct Medal, the National Defense Service Medal, the Afghanistan Campaign Medal with Campaign Stars, the Global War on Terrorism Service Medal, the Army Service Ribbon, the Overseas Service Ribbon, the Combat Infantryman's Badge and the Parachutist Badge.
